使用DevOps进行持续测试

以敏捷和DevOps的速度进行持续测试——是“每一步都进行测试”,而不是最后的“QA”.

devops-qa

 

连续测试 执行过程是自动的吗 测试 作为软件交付管道的一部分,以便尽快获得与软件发布候选版本相关的业务风险的反馈,并帮助实现持续的质量 & 改进.

 

连续测试 没有测试自动化是无法实现的. 它需要一个或多个级别的自动化测试, 例如单元测试, API测试, Web服务测试, 端到端功能UI测试, 但并不需要在所有级别上自动化测试.

 

敏捷和DevOps使持续测试变得至关重要. 然而,, 软件测试仍然被遗留的工具和过时的过程所主导——这不能满足当今数字转换的需求. 市场上出现了用于持续测试的新的自动化工具,如Katalon Studio, Experitest, 硒, 量角器, 傀儡师, Tricentis托斯卡, bat365官方网站必须将它们与Jenkins等CI工具一起使用, Travis-CI, 等.

持续测试是一个精益的过程,在每一步的质量. 它包括高质量的用户故事, 质量环境, 单元测试质量, 和质量性能测试. 连续测试 “每一步都是测试”而不是最后的“QA”. 它还将测试任务从Ops转移到最后, 通过更早地进行测试并一直进行测试. CT也增加了更多的任务.

 

在QualiTLabs,bat365官方网站遵循以下一些基于应用测试(AUT)的方法

  • 使用测试自动化进行持续测试
  • 敏捷开发中的持续测试
  • 自动化整个发布部署,排除包括运行自动化单元测试在内的人为错误, 功能测试, 性能, 和安全测试
  • 为自动化测试创建一个健壮的框架,以最小化自动化中的错误
  • 使用云进行跨浏览器/环境/设备测试
  • 在开发过程中通过单元测试或使用TDD方法消除更多的bug
  • 从传统的QA转向DevOps的QA方法

 

持续测试的优点

  • 尽早测试,经常测试,尽早修复
  • 以敏捷和DevOps的速度实现质量
  • 永远不要将损坏的代码发布到产品中
  • 自动化测试执行和持续的质量监控
  • 自动化测试报告
  • 更快地进入市场,成为市场领导者

 

尝试bat365官方网站的服务

bat365官方网站提供无成本试点
友情链接: 1 2